The tasha drummers provide the objective of the snare drummers inside a drumming ensemble. The music follows a usual phone and reaction structure and moves from a common variation of 4 – five rhythm designs. There are several flag (Dwaj) dancers at the peak in the ensemble who assist guide the procession and likewise dance to the heartbeat of the rhythm, holding your complete procession in sync and by the due date. When the maanche Ganpati mandals commenced inviting the pathaks, there was a need for that lyrical seem which helped decrease the double entendre music blaring over the loudspeakers in the sixties. 

“These pathaks exercise for 3 several hours daily Virtually one particular and 50 % months ahead of the Ganesh festival. The dhol sequence usually has five to 7 beats with which the pathaks think of their very own variations,” states Thakur. 

The immersion procession eventually causes the Arabian Sea, where by the idol is immersed in h2o. This act symbolizes the cycle of development and dissolution, and it marks the end from the Ganesh Chaturthi festival.

The explanation for the bend adhere is because of the goat pores and skin. This really is slender like 80-100gsm paper, Hence the stick needs to be bent to avoid piercing the pores and skin. The bass adhere or Dagga may be the thicker of The 2 and it is bent within an eighth- or quarter-round arc on the tip here that strikes the instrument.[two] The other stick, often called the teeli, is far thinner and versatile and used to Engage in the upper Be aware conclude of the instrument.[3]
